I know the book calls for TCH oil for the hyddraulic system. Qusetion is: Is there another oil on the market that is acceptable such as the oil Tractor Supply sells or Advance Auto's Coastal oil. Also what weight should the hydraulic oil be? Thanks, Keith
 
I have been using WalMart oil, that is in a 2 gal. blue container, for about 6 years in my Case 480D. Has worked great for me.
 
any hydraulic oil will work in the hydraulic system but i would only use tch in the torque conveter we run hytran in the in ours but thats because we buy it in 55 gal drums
